This design style, which emerged in the mid-20th century, is characterized by clean lines, organic forms, and an emphasis on functionality. If you're looking to create a cozy yet stylish small living room, mid-century modern is the perfect choice. Start by selecting a color palette that reflects the era—think muted tones combined with pops of bold colors. Incorporate iconic furniture pieces such as a low-profile sofa, a sleek coffee table, and accent chairs with tapered legs. These elements not only save space but also create a visually open environment that feels larger than it is.Lighting plays a crucial role in mid-century modern design. Opt for statement lighting fixtures like a starburst chandelier or a minimalist floor lamp. These pieces not only illuminate your space but also serve as artful focal points. Additionally, consider using mirrors strategically to enhance natural light and create an illusion of depth in your small living room.When it comes to decor, embrace minimalism. Choose a few key decorative items that reflect your personality without overcrowding the space. Vintage-inspired art pieces or abstract prints can add visual interest while staying true to the design aesthetic. Plants also play a significant role in mid-century modern spaces, bringing life and freshness into your home. A few well-placed houseplants can enhance the overall ambiance and make your small living room feel inviting.Another essential aspect of mid-century modern design is the integration of indoor and outdoor spaces. If you have a small balcony or patio, consider extending your living area with sliding glass doors that allow for a seamless transition.
